Menkea australis Lehm.
Family Brassicaceae
Menkea australis Lehm. APNI*

Description: Prostrate glabrous herb with stems 5–25 cm long.

Basal leaves spathulate, 1–3 cm long, entire to pinnatisect, tapering into petiole, withering without falling; stem leaves oblanceolate, entire or shallowly lobed, ± sessile.

Sepals 1–2 mm long. Petals c. 2 mm long, white to pink or mauve. Silicula obovate to elliptic, 3–7 mm long, 2–3.5 mm wide, markedly flattened, septum absent; pedicel erect or spreading, 5–10 mm long. Short-lived herb, widespread in inland areas.

Distribution and occurrence:
NSW subdivisions: NWP, SWP, NFWP
Other Australian states: Vic. W.A. S.A.
